Technical Questions
What
format should artowork be submitted in?
Artwork should be camera ready,
color separated with trapping and as close to
size
as possible.We prefer vector artwork from either Adobe Illustrator 10
and lower or Freehand. Send your art files to this address: orders@shirtgraphics.com
I
only have my artwork printed on paper or an old T-shirt, is that OK?
Sure, we can work from that. Choose
the best quality and largest sample of the artwork that you have. If
you don't have the artwork in a computer file, printed would be next
best.
Can
artwork be submitted on a disk or emailed?
No floppy disk or hardisks. We prefer
artwork to be emailed to: orders@shirtgraphics.com
or placed on a CD. Either PC or Mac
is fine.
What
computer programs do you use?
Adobe Illustrator 10, Freehand, or Photoshop
7.0. We are MAC based but acept PC files.
Do
you need color separations?
Yes. Images with more than one color need to be color
separated (each color
printed in black and white on a separate sheet
of paper or vellum film). If you
donŐt have the means to produce separations, we can provide them for
a fee.
Can
you match PMS colors?
Yes, but there is a color matching fee.
How
big can an image be printed?
The maximum imprint area on adult size shirts is 17"
wide by 15" high.
Can
customers supply their own screens?
No. Our presses may require different sized screens.
Do
customers own their own screens?
No, the screen fee is a labor charge which covers the
set-up and cleaning
of the screens.
